Q:

In economics,"capital" refers to

A) mineral resources B) the money in one's pocket
C) consumer goods D) buildings and equipment
 
Answer & Explanation Answer: D) buildings and equipment

Explanation:

Capital refers to buildings and equipment i.e, goods which are used by workers to produce other goods such as machinery, land, ...

Capital has a number of related meanings in economics, finance, and accounting.

In economics, Capital comprises one of the four major factors of production, the others being land, labor, and entrepreneurship.

In finance and accounting, capital generally refers to financial wealth, especially that used to start or maintain a business.

Q:

Oparin is known for his hypothesis on

A) origin of species B) origin of life
C) one germ one disease D) one gene one enzyme
 
Answer & Explanation Answer: B) origin of life

Explanation:

A. J . Oparin was the first to propose the origin of life from inorganic chemical atoms like Oxygen, Hydrogen, Nitrogen and Carbon.

Q:

Who invented Electrocardiograph(EKG)?

Answer

The EKG was invented by Willem Einthoven in 1903 and is used to monitor and analyze past and present heart activity in an individual.
